Tips for Substitutions and Variations
Don’t hesitate to get creative! Here are some ideas for making Doyle's Mulligan your own:
-
Beer Variations: If you're feeling adventurous, branch out from your usual beer selection. A citrusy wheat beer can add a bright note, while a dark beer can deepen the flavor profile.
-
Vodka Alternatives: If you’re not a fan of pepper vodka, try using a flavored vodka such as garlic or jalapeño for a different spice element.
-
Garnishes: Elevate your drink with garnishes! A slice of jalapeño, a sprinkle of black pepper, or even a rim coated with chili powder can enhance the flavor and presentation.

Step-by-Step Recipe
Ready to mix up your very own Doyle’s Mulligan? Follow these simple steps:
-
Frost Your Beer Mug: Place your beer mug in the freezer for a frosty experience.
-
Add the Shot of Vodka: Once your mug is chilled, pour in a shot of pepper vodka for that spicy kick.
-
Top with Your Favorite Beer: Fill the rest of the mug with the beer of your choice. Let the flavors mingle, and enjoy!
